[PATCH v6 0/2] btrfs: Replace kmap() with kmap_local_page() in zstd.c

This is a little series which serves the purpose to replace kmap() with
kmap_local_page() in btrfs/zstd.c. Actually this task is only accomplished
in patch 2/2.

Instead patch 1/2 is a pre-requisite for the above-mentioned replacement,
however, above all else, it has the purpose to conform the prototypes of
__kunmap_{local,atomic}() to their own correct semantics. Since those
functions don't make changes to the memory pointed by their arguments,
change the type of those arguments to become pointers to const void.

v5 -> v6: Delete an unnecessary assignment in 2/2 (thanks to Ira Weiny).

v4 -> v5: Use plain page_address() for pages which cannot come from Highmem
(instead of kmapping them); remove unnecessary initializations to NULL
in 2/2 (thanks to Ira Weiny).

v3 -> v4: Resend and add linux-mm to the list of recipients (thanks to
Andrew Morton).
